2017-08-18 6 views
-2

.jsファイルの "././mail/contact_me.php"に出くわしました。最初に、これは相対パス "../../mail/contact_me.php"の構文エラーだと思っていました。しかし、私がこれに変更すると、スクリプトは機能しません。したがって、私は "././"に意味があると推測します。私はウェブ上でこれに関する議論を見つけることができませんでした。代替の相対パス形式

+1

[./(ドットスラッシュ)はHTMLファイルのパスの場所に関して何を参照していますか?](https://stackoverflow.com/questions/7591240/what-does-dot-slash- htmlファイルパスの場所を参照) – DrakaSAN

+0

ありがとうDraka。 – user3811448

答えて

0

は現在のディレクトリです。
../は、現在のディレクトリの親ディレクトリ用です。
したがって、../../は、「ディレクトリ構造で2つのレベルに上がる」ことを意味します。
././は、現在のディレクトリを2回参照するため、おそらくタイプミスです。これは構文エラーではありませんが、冗長です。 ./mail/contact_me.phpは同等である必要があります。

+0

Martinに感謝します。理解しています。 – user3811448